Devilled Crab in Cucumber Cups

Devilled Crab in Cucumber Cups are an easy and fun way to being a meal. |

INGREDIENTS:
- 3 cup(s) , Crab Meat Cooked
- 2 whole , Hard Boiled Eggs Chopped
- 1/4 cup(s) , Lemon Grass Sliced Fine
- 1/4 cup(s) , Onion Chopped
- 2 tablespoon(s) , Nam-Prik Pao
- 2 tablespoon(s) , Fish Sauce
- 3 tablespoon(s) , Lime Juice
- 1 tablespoon(s) , Sugar
- 2 tablespoon(s) , Scallions Chopped
- 2 tablespoon(s) , Corianders Leaves Chopped
- 3 whole , Cucumbers
|
|
| Instructions: |
|
Mix all ingredients together and fill cucumber cups. To make cucumber cups: Peel and cut cucumber crosswise approximately 3 inches thick, and scoop out seeds to make cups. Mix 1/2 cup white vinegar with 1/2 cup water, 1 tb salt, and 1/4 cup sugar. Add the cucumber cups and marinate for about 1/2 hour, then drain off and discard liquid. |
